From 4a216c299320240e53e9e16d26d8ebf91f81b766 Mon Sep 17 00:00:00 2001 From: "Kyle J. McKay" Date: Fri, 19 Sep 2014 14:21:31 -0700 Subject: [PATCH] Project.pm: enable repack.writebitmaps when creating repositories Best used with Git version 2.1.1 or later. --- Girocco/Project.pm | 2 ++ 1 file changed, 2 insertions(+) diff --git a/Girocco/Project.pm b/Girocco/Project.pm index b71a590..37a8422 100644 --- a/Girocco/Project.pm +++ b/Girocco/Project.pm @@ -570,6 +570,8 @@ sub _setup { $self->{creationtime} = strftime("%Y-%m-%dT%H:%M:%SZ", $S, $M, $H, $d, $m, $y, -1, -1, -1); system($Girocco::Config::git_bin, '--git-dir='.$self->{path}, 'config', 'girocco.creationtime', $self->{creationtime}) == 0 or die "setting girocco.creationtime failed: $?"; + system($Girocco::Config::git_bin, '--git-dir='.$self->{path}, 'config', 'repack.writebitmaps', 'true') == 0 + or die "enabling repack.writebitmaps failed: $?"; # /info must have right permissions, # and git init didn't do it for some reason. -- 2.11.4.GIT